IGNJATOVIĆ: SUPPORT FOR BIATHLON TRACK CONSTRUCTION

JAHORINA, MARCH 4 /SRNA/ – The Minister of Family, Youth and Sport of Republika Srpska Irena Ignjatović has met today with Olympian Strahinja Erić and announced that the Ministry will support the construction of a biathlon track at Dvorišta on Jahorina.

Ignjatović congratulated Erić, as well as Marko Šljivić and Teodora Delipara, who competed at the Olympic Games in Italy this year. "Their placement and participation there is a great success," Ignjatović said. Erić expressed satisfaction with the meeting, stating that they discussed both problems and solutions. "The track at Dvorišta is very important to us, because that is where we took our first biathlon steps," Erić told the press. Erić expressed confidence that, with the Ministry’s support, the Olympic spirit will be maintained. The Vice President of the Romanija Ski Club Tomislav Lopatić said that no work has been done on the tracks at Dvorišta for a long time and that the Ministry’s assistance will be valuable for the advancement of the sport. "The track plan has been completed, and we have obtained all the necessary licenses. An asphalt track would be very significant, which we discussed today. Our children are still training on public roads because we do not have adequate tracks," Lopatić said. He added that better training conditions will result in better sporting achievements.
